Yesterday, the Ministry of Health and Community Protection announced that 291 thousand and three new tests had been conducted, in line with its plan to expand and increase the scope of examinations in the country, with the aim of early detection, counting cases infected with the emerging coronavirus (Covid-19), and those in contact with them and isolating them.

The intensification of investigation procedures and the expansion of examinations at the state level contributed to the detection of 1,675 new cases of the virus.

Thus, the total number of registered cases is 634,582.

The ministry also announced the death of eight people from the repercussions of the infection, bringing the number of deaths in the country to 1819 cases.

The Ministry expressed its regret and condolences to the families of the deceased, and its wishes for a speedy recovery for all the injured, calling on community members to cooperate with health authorities, adhere to instructions, and adhere to social distancing, to ensure the health and safety of all.

The Ministry also announced the recovery of 1,556 new cases of people infected with the emerging coronavirus (Covid-19), and their full recovery from the symptoms of the disease, bringing the total number of recovery cases to 612,998 cases.

The Ministry announced the provision of 81,142 new doses of the “Covid-19” vaccine, bringing the total doses it provided until yesterday to 15,362,342 doses, and the vaccine distribution rate is 155.33 doses per 100 people.

This comes in line with the Ministry's plan to provide the vaccine to citizens and residents, in an effort to reach the acquired immunity resulting from vaccination, in order to help reduce the number of cases and control the "Covid-19" virus.
